"Fore-Edge" books were all the rage in the 1780s to the 1830s years. These books had illustrations hand-painted on the edge of the pages, which is opposite from the binding. Learn more about this interesting art form and what these literary treasures for sale.

About the Author

Ralph and Terry Kovel are the authors of more than 95 books about collecting and antiques, including the best-selling annual price guide “Kovels’ Antiques and Collectibles Price List.” Hailed by Parade magazine as “the duke and duchess of the antiques world,” the Kovels publish “Kovels on Antiques and Collectibles” (an award-winning newsletter) and write a syndicated weekly newspaper column distributed to more than 150 newspapers.
